WASHINGTON, D.C. - The Washington Redskins fired head coach Jim Zorn early today and have scheduled a news conference for this afternoon to announce the move, according to several reports.
According to The Washington Post, Zorn was fired shortly after the Redskins' plane returned from San Diego, where Washington lost 23-20 to finish 4-12, the team's worst record in 15 years.
Zorn, 56, finished his two-year stint with a 12-20 record, and had one year left on his contract.
Zorn's dismissal has been expected for months. The front office stripped him of his play-calling duties in late October, and owner Dan Snyder has interviewed assistant coach Jerry Gray for the job, according to the Fritz Pollard Alliance, which monitors minority hiring in the NFL.
Gray's interview was an effort to comply with the Rooney Rule, which requires that teams consider a minority candidate for the head coaching position. If the NFL deems that the Rooney Rule has been satisfied, the Redskins are free to act quickly to hire a replacement for Zorn. Former Denver Broncos coach Mike Shanahan is considered the favorite.
Zorn's replacement will be Washington's seventh coach since Snyder bought the team in 1999. Playing a substantial part in the decision will be Bruce Allen, who was hired as the general manager last month. Allen was fired as the Tampa Bay Buccaneers' general manager after the 2008 season.
